Hey everyone
Last week, my phone started getting the "moisture detected" error, but I was still able to charge it because the error comes and goes (and it's still present). Fast charging doesn't seem to work anymore though.
Today, I wanted to back up my stuff to smart switch on my PC, but when I connected my phone, my PC isn't picking it up anymore, it's only charging it.
I suspect that my charging port is damaged, but I know that the entire motherboard needs to be replaced. How do I backup my data to my PC if I can't use the USB option?

Try backing up your data on Samsung's Cloud server or Microsoft's One drive. Once you've got your phone fixed, then download the data to your phone/ PC.
